It's a bad joke. Heart failure is defined by reduced cardaic output, i.e. the heart doesn't pump as much blood to the rest of the body. It's not so much that you extract water, but you rather you retain it because the kidneys don't get enough blood. The powerful diuretic, Lasix, is given to heart failure patients so they don't drown in their own fluid.
You do, however, already have the ability to extract water from various sources. The nephrons of your kidneys extract water from urine, and so can large intestines from your poop. Also, I believe water flows through the stomach mucosa. The nephrons of your kidneys also have additional hormonal regulation that extract water. It's called RAAS (renin-angiotensin-aldosterone system) which uses sodium ions to retain water. There is also the anti-diuretic hormone that comes from the posterior pituitary gland.
